| name | aws-spot-strategy |
| description | Design an interruption-resilient EC2 Spot instance strategy with fallback configurations |
You are an AWS Spot instance expert. Design a cost-optimal, interruption-resilient Spot strategy.
This skill is instruction-only. It does not execute any AWS CLI commands or access your AWS account directly. You provide the data; Claude analyzes it.
Ask the user to provide one or more of the following (the more provided, the better the analysis):
aws ec2 describe-instances \
--query 'Reservations[].Instances[].{ID:InstanceId,Type:InstanceType,State:State.Name,AZ:Placement.AvailabilityZone}' \
--output json
aws autoscaling describe-auto-scaling-groups --output json
aws ce get-cost-and-usage \
--time-period Start=2025-02-01,End=2025-04-01 \
--granularity MONTHLY \
--filter '{"Dimensions":{"Key":"SERVICE","Values":["Amazon EC2"]}}' \
--group-by '[{"Type":"DIMENSION","Key":"USAGE_TYPE"}]' \
--metrics BlendedCost
Minimum required IAM permissions to run the CLI commands above (read-only):
{
"Version": "2012-10-17",
"Statement": [{
"Effect": "Allow",
"Action": ["ec2:DescribeInstances", "ec2:DescribeSpotPriceHistory", "autoscaling:Describe*", "ce:GetCostAndUsage"],
"Resource": "*"
}]
}
If the user cannot provide any data, ask them to describe: your workloads (stateless/stateful, fault-tolerant?), current EC2 instance types, and approximate monthly EC2 spend.
